We are back in podcast form for 2018. Thank you for your patience, with a studio move and a change in our structure its taken us some time to get to where we are today, but we start podcasting once again with a truly inspirational interview with local man Duy Huynh.
In this very special Asian Pop Radio podcast, we speak to the man who, with his family were refugees who left Vietnam for a better life in very turbulent times. Duy speaks of the journey he and his family took via boat, to Australia and the difficulties those on the boat endured, some of whom did not make it to land again.
Duy also speaks of happier times where his grand mother effectively introduced the world to the concept of Bánh mì, pretty much a stable go-to food for lunch times in Australia today.
This podcast highlights the importance of welcoming refugees of all backgrounds, how our society has changed for the better with thanks to years of migrants making Australia their home and provides an example of a success story that changed the face of fast food locally.
